Q:  How do I take care of my Cake or Cupcakes?
A:  To keep your Cake or Cupcakes as fresh as possible, we suggest that you keep them refrigerated until at least ½ hour before serving. To achieve maximum flavor, Cakes or Cupcakes are best served at room temperature. Always keep them away from any heat sources and out of the reach of your children and pets.

Q:  I love your “Under the Sea / Alaska” cake!  Is it real?
A:  The “Under the Sea” and “Alaska” cake is a real fake cake. It is a dummy cake on the inside (the inside is Styrofoam) and the outside is made with real cake decorating products (i.e. gumpaste, fondant, royal icing, food coloring gel, etc.).  All the pieces are hand sculpted and this cake can be recreated on a cake without the Styrofoam. These two cakes are only available in the size and décor show.  We cannot scale down or “take pieces” of décor from either cake. The “Under the Sea” cake took our decorator 25 hours just to sculpt all the figures. That time does not include drying time or assembly.  It is a truly amazing cake and continues to astound the staff.  Both the “Alaska” and “Under the Sea” cakes are award winners and took first place in their categories at the 2010 Great American Cake Show in Westminster, MD.
